181 8488 6988

首页加油系统加油小程序微信加油小程序开发需要哪些技术

微信加油小程序开发需要哪些技术

2026-04-09

昆明

返回列表

在数字化浪潮席卷传统行业的目前,开发一款微信加油小程序已成为能源行业转型升级的重要路径。其成功并非偶然,而是构建在一套完整且协同的技术体系之上。这不仅要求开发者熟练掌握微信小程序原生框架与组件化前端技术,以实现流畅的用户交互体验,还深度依赖云服务架构提供的高可用后端支持,确保业务逻辑稳定运行与数据高效处理。第三方服务(如准确定位与无缝支付)的平滑集成、贯穿始终的数据安全策略、系统化的测试与运维保障,以及基于数据分析的持续迭代优化,共同构成了小程序从概念走向成熟应用的技术基石。唯有全面掌控并灵活运用这些关键技术环节,才能打造出真正满足市场需求的加油服务平台,在激烈竞争中脱颖而出。

一、 小程序框架与核心语法

微信加油小程序的骨架由官方框架搭建。开发者需掌握WXML与WXSS,它们分别负责页面结构和样式。WXML通过数据绑定和事件处理实现动态渲染,而WXSS则确保界面美观且适配不同屏幕。JavaScript逻辑层处理用户交互、调用API并与服务器通信。小程序的生命周期管理至关重要,它决定了页面和应用的初始化、显示和销毁时机。合理使用这些基础技术是保证小程序稳定运行的前提。

1. 视图层WXML:用于构建页面结构,支持数据绑定和列表渲染。

2. 样式层WXSS:定义组件样式,具备响应式适配能力。

3. 逻辑层逻辑层JavaScript:处理业务逻辑,响应用户操作。

4. 配置文件:JSON文件全局配置页面路径和窗口表现。

5. 生命周期函数:管理页面初始化、显示、隐藏等状态。

6. 基础组件库:使用按钮、输入框等内置组件加速开发。

二、 前端交互与界面优化

加油小程序的前端需兼顾功能性与美观性。通过自定义组件可复用油枪选择器、金额键盘等模块。动画API能够模拟加油进度、提升操作反馈。地图组件集成展示附近油站,并支持路线规划。下拉刷新和上拉加载优化长列表浏览体验。性能方面,需注意图片懒加载和减少setData调用频率,以保障页面流畅度。这些细节直接影响用户留存率。

1. 自定义组件开发:封装油站列表、订单卡片等业务组件。

2. 交互动效实现:使用CSS3动画增强用户操作反馈。

3. 地图功能集成:调用腾讯地图API实现地理位置服务。

4. 列表性能优化:分页加载和虚拟滚动处理大量数据。

5. 网络状态适配:针对弱网环境设计降级方案。

6. 主题色彩系统:建立统一的视觉规范提升品牌感。

三、 后端服务与数据管理

虽然小程序强调轻量,但加油业务涉及实时油价、订单管理等复杂逻辑,必须部署专业后端。云开发TCB提供开箱即用的数据库和存储能力,支持快速迭代。传统方案可采用Vue.js或Java构建微服务,RESTfulAPI规范前后端通信。数据库设计需合理规划用户、油站、订单等表结构,结构,确保事务一致性。接口鉴权和限流机制保障服务安全稳定。

1. 云开发模式选择:基于云函数实现业务逻辑无服务器化。

2. 数据库设计原则:关系型与非关系型数据库结合使用。

3. API接口设计:定义清晰的接口文档和错误码规范。

4. 用户会话管理:通过Token机制维持登录状态。

5. 实时数据推送:WebSocket保持油价变动的即时同步。

6. 缓存策略制定:Redis缓存热点数据降低数据库压力。

四、 云服务与第三方集成

微信生态提供丰富云服务支撑小程序运营。内容安全API自动审核用户评论,防范违规风险。云托管保障服务弹性伸缩,应对加油高峰时段。消息订阅模板向用户发送支付成功、优惠到期等通知。集成高德地图补充位置服务,对接发票平台实现电子开票。这些第三方服务显著扩展了小程序能力边界。

1. 微信云开发:一站式集成存储、数据库和计算资源。

2. 内容安全审核:自动识别图片和文本违规内容。

3. 消息订阅系统:合规引导用户授权并及时触达。

4. 支付SDK对接:实现微信支付与退款全流程。

5. 物流接口集成:支持洗车配件等衍生品配送。

6. 大数据分析平台:连接腾讯分析可视化用户行为。

五、 支付与安全风控

支付环节是小程序商业闭环的关键。微信支付接口需正确处理预支付、回调验证和订单状态同步。安全方面,采用HTTPS加密传输,防止数据泄露。后台敏感操作设置二次验证,账户异常登录及时告警。业务风控模型识别套现、刷、等行为,维护平台公平。定期安全扫描修复漏洞,构建防御体系。

1. 支付流程实现:对接Native支付和JSAPI支付模式。

2. 数据加密传输:SSL证书保障通信链路安全。

3. 防机制:通过设备指纹和行为分析识别异常。

4. 权限分级管理:RBAC模型控制后台操作权限。

5. 合规性设计:遵循个人信息保护法收集使用数据。

6. 应急响应预案:建立安全事件快速处置流程。

六、 测试发布与运维监控

开发完成后需经过多轮测试。单元测试覆盖工具函数,集成测试验证端到端流程。真机调试检查Android/iOS兼容性,性能测试评估首屏加载速度。上线前提交微信审核,确保符合平台规范。运维阶段监控错误日志和性能指标,设置自动化报警。采用灰度发布策略降低更新风险,保障用户体验连续性。

1. 多端兼容测试:覆盖不同操作系统和微信版本。

2. 性能基准测试:监测首屏时间及内存占用指标。

3. 自动化测试脚本:编写冒烟测试和回归测试用例。

4. 持续集成流程:自动化构建、测试和部署。

5. 实时监控大盘:追踪崩溃率和业务核心指标。

6. 用户反馈闭环:建立问题收集和处理机制。

在能源行业数字化的浪潮中,微信加油小程序绝非简单的能力嫁接,而是深度融合技术与场景的智慧结晶。它考验的不仅是开发者的编程能力,更是对安全风控、用户体验和商业逻辑的综合把控。唯有将每项技术准确嵌入业务脉络,让每次代码提交都服务于真实需求,才能在便捷性与安全性之间找到理想平衡点,蕞终打造出经得起市场检验的数字能源新基建。

18184886988

昆明网站建设公司电话

昆明网站建设公司地址

云南省昆明市盘龙区金尚俊园2期2栋3206号